Pre-soak your feet, or after your shower/bath, then use a foot file or pumice stone to lightly rub on the areas that need to be softened. Be careful, don't remove too much skin! It is there for a reason, to protect your foot and if you remove it too quickly your foot can be very tender and sore. After this is done then use some type of moisturizer, lotion or shea butter (is real good).

this depends on where the dead skin is, and how bad it is. dry skin is dead skin, etc. Exfoliation is the best way to get rid of mild dead skin, there are body scrubs... salt scrubs are harsher and remove more than sugar scrubs. there are also exfoliating tools, for instance pumice stone (typically used on feet) or battery operated brushes for face and body.

It is generally not necessary to remove dead skin from a cut finger wound. The body will naturally slough off dead skin as the wound heals. However, if there is excessive dead skin buildup or it is obstructing proper healing, a healthcare professional may recommend debridement.
There are several ways to get callouses off your feet. A professional manicurist will first soften the skin on your feet by soaking them in warm water and soap or Epsom salts, then remove the callouses using a special tool. You can also use a pumice stone on your feet in the shower or bath, making sure to first soak your feet in warm or hot water to soften the dead skin before trying to remove it.
